Aperçu du produit

VIP is produced in the gut, pancreas, and hypothalamus. It stimulates heart contractions, causes vasodilation, lowers blood pressure, increases glycogen breakdown, relaxes smooth muscle in the trachea, stomach, and gallbladder, and modulates GI motility and secretion. In the brain, it affects blood flow, melatonin production, and circadian rhythm.

Mécanisme d'action

VIP binds to VPAC1 and VPAC2 receptors, triggering G-alpha-mediated signaling cascades that increase cAMP and PKA activity. PKA then activates transcriptional factors including CREB, and regulates molecular clock genes Per1 and Per2 for circadian rhythm modulation. VIP is co-released with GABA, influencing neural synchronization.

Principaux avantages

Anti-Inflammatory — Decreases most inflammatory cytokines. Shows anti-inflammatory effects in arthritis models and may support immune tolerance by suppressing Th1 and promoting Th2 responses.

Immune Balance — Studied for autoimmune/inflammatory diseases including rheumatoid arthritis, ulcerative colitis, multiple sclerosis, Parkinson's disease, and Crohn's disease.

Brain Health — Neuroprotective properties that increase cellular resistance against oxidative stress, support neuronal survival, and exert anti-anxiety effects.

Antimicrobial Activity — Displays antimicrobial properties against various pathogens including Streptococcus, E. coli, Pseudomonas, and Candida in laboratory studies.

Metabolic Regulation — Influences blood glucose, insulin, and leptin levels. VIP-deficient models show elevated glucose and enhanced sweet taste preference linked to leptin resistance.
